Revolut launched a new digital currency: EURR is pegged to the euro.
The British neobank Revolut has launched a new settlement system in circulation — the EURR stablecoin. The digital currency is pegged to the euro. The cryptocurrency issuer is the company Bridge. Bridge will carry out the management and safekeeping of the assets that fully back the new stablecoin.
Where EURR is available and how it works
At the first stage, access to the EURR stablecoin is provided to a limited number of users in several countries:

Denmark.
Poland.
Portugal.
Later this year, Revolut plans to expand access to the new financial instrument to other markets of the European Economic Area.

The new instrument has already been integrated into the Revolut mobile app. This allows users to exchange euros for cryptocurrency and vice versa. The company says this is the first step in a large-scale strategy to launch stablecoins pegged to other major currencies.
